Today the situation is seems to be very pathetic for Govt. to acquire any land with 70-80% clause and to return the land in 5 years if its not used.But fact os that Govt. cannot guarantee setting up of industry will finish in 5 years or more.Moreover in defence or nuclear Projects it will take time. Anna Hazare is also unnecessarily creating rumour that Govt. will not ask for farmers consent but the truth is that ‘There are only five categories where there will be mandatory land acquisition i.e. Defense, Road, Rail, Irrigation,PPP model & Industrial corridors. For all other land acquisition issues including Coal Blocks,PPP etc 70% consent clause still exist.


One other point should also be noted that Govt. will give 4 times compensation to the affected farmers,it means if farmers land's market price is 25 lakhs then he will suppose to get 1 Crore Rupees with which he can buy 4 times space at other place.
